Mixed cream cheese, some sharp cheddar, a little mozzarella, grinder salt and pepper, a little garlic powder, and a few drops of Worchestershire. The chicken was shredded and diced up, and I diced some shrimp and left others whole in mine. Sliced the side of the roasted chiles and cleaned out seeds and membrane. Stuffed them full as I could get them. Cooked 375 for about 25 minutes. Weren't pretty, but boy, they sure were good!
